Template:Short description Template:Infobox organization CESAER is a non-profit association of universities of science and technology in Europe. CESAER was founded on 10 May 1990, seated in the Castle of Arenberg in Leuven, Belgium. The association has 58 universities of science and technology in 28 countries. The name CESAER was formed as an abbreviation for "Conference of European Schools for Advanced Engineering Education and Research", but today only the short form CESAER is used.<ref>Template:Cite web</ref>
The combined member institutions of the association have over 1.1 million students enrolled and employ over 96,000 academic staff.<ref>Template:Cite web</ref> The current President until end of 2025 is Orla Feely,<ref>Template:Cite web</ref> Rector of University College Dublin.<ref>Template:Cite web</ref>
